John Rosengrant does models as a hobby when not working
in the film industry on such films as Avatar, Terminator, Jurassic
Park [Goggle for more]. There is a good article about him
in the 2nd Qtr issue of Figure International. This WWII diorama
knock me over. One of his entries in the Southern California Area
Historical Miniatures Society Show for 2006. It's entitled "Calm
Before The Storm."
